Hello to everyone and since I am new to this forum I hope I have posted this question in the correct topic category.
I have a David Bradley 2 wheel tractor that I think is model 575135. I am wanting to put some cleated tires on it for better traction and am searching for something way cheaper than the ones at Gemplers. I believe the originals to have been 6.70 x 15 Allstate Ag treads. Can someone confirm this size to be correct? It has really old, slick 6.70 x 15 6ply U-Haul tires on it now. I have found some implement traction tires and also some skid steer tires in similar sizes but I don't know exactly how wide my current rims are. Can someone also tell me what the width of the original wheels for those 6.70 x 15 tires would be?
Thanks in advance for all the help and information.
